TEXT PRAYERS are the modern way to spread the message according to Church leaders in Greater Manchester. The Bishop of Bolton and the Bishop of Manchester, have launched a website which lets people pray via computer or mobile phone. Log on, type your prayers, then click on an ‘Amen’ icon to post them. All prayers received via www.SayOneForMe.org for the next 40 days will be put on the site and the bishops will remember them in their Easter prayers.
WAS THERE REALLY A UFO FLYING OVER KNUTSFORD? The UFO is being investigated by the Civil Aviation Authority after it narrowly missed hitting an airliner coming in to land at Manchester Airport, back in 1995. The sighting is described in previously top-secret files released by the Ministry of Defence (MoD) today.
BODDINGTONS BREWERY SITE IS TO BECOME TRAVELODGE. The former brewery closed in 2006 after production moved elsewhere. It was then used as a venue for the Warehouse Project events before being demolished in 2007. Travelodge have confirmed they are to submit a planning application for a 200-bed hotel on the site. If the plan is approved, it could be open by June 2011.
